Mindfulness training enhances flow state and mental health among baseball players in Taiwan
Psychology Research and Behavior Management December 1, 2018 Jian-Hong Chen, Po-hsin Tsai, Yin-Chou Lin et al.
A 4-week mindful sport performance enhancement (MSPE) workshop improved flow state, cognitive anxiety, eating disorder symptoms, and sleep disturbance in an amateur baseball team of 21 athletes in Taiwan. Flow state improvements persisted at a 4-week follow-up, and mindfulness ability was strongly linked to flow state. The findings suggest MSPE can benefit both performance and mental health in team sports.
